While the presence of these molecules is not proof of ancient life on Mars, scientists say it shows we could detect chemical ...
During the partial solar eclipse on March 29, 2025, a weird "double sunrise" will grace the skies between Canada's St Lawrence River and the Bay of Fundy, via the easternmost point of the U.S.